8- Care and Cleaning
8.3 Defrosting
The defrosting of the refrigerator and the freezer compartment are done automatically;
no manual operation is needed.
8.4 Replacing the LED-lamp
The lamp adopts LED as its light source, featuring low energy consumption and long ser-
vice life. If there is any abnormality, please contact the customer service . See CUSTOMER
SERVICE.
WARNING!
Do not replace the LED lamp yourself, it must only be replaced by either the manufac-
turer or the authorised service agent.

Parameters of the lamp:
Voltage 12V; Max Power: 9.5 W

8.6 Non-use for a longer period
If the appliance is not used for an extended period of time, and you will not use the Holi-
day-function for the refrigerator:
▶ Take out the food.
▶ Unplug the power cord.
▶ Clean the appliance as described above.
▶ Keep the door and freezer drawers/door open to prevent the creation of bad odours inside.
Notice: Switch off
Turn the appliance off only if strictly necessary.
